Ally Sheedy
Alexandra Elizabeth Sheedy born in June 1962 was an American Actress. Her film debut was during 1983's Bad Boys she became known as one of the Brat Pack group of actors. She was also on the screen in WarGames (1983) The Breakfast Club (1985) as well as Short Circuit (1986). Sheedy received the Independent Spirit Award as Best Female Lead for her role in Lisa Cholodenko's High Art (1998). Ally Sheedy was born in America and she is both an actress and an author.
